Abstract
Carbanions derived from 2-alkyl pyridines and 2-alkyl quinolines react with one or two molecules of isothiocyanate, depending upon the carbanion and isothiocyanate structures. Thiocarboxamides 12, 13, or dithiocarboxamides 1, 3, 5, 7, 9, 11, are obtained. When dithiocarboxamides are formed, cyclisation occurs by further oxidation giving a dithiolan derivative. A single crystal structure study of one of these dithiocarboxamides was carried out. The crystals belong to space group P2(1)/c, with a = 12.874 (1), b = 10.867 (1), c = 15.624 (1) angstrom, beta = 109.13 (1)-degrees, Z = 4, M = 389.54, D(x) = 1.253 g cm-3, mu = 2.3 mm-1, F (000) = 816. The packing of molecules show stocking with two hydrogen bonds: N-H . . . N (N-N distance 2.673 angstrom) and N-H . . . S (N-S distance 3.338 angstrom).
